This artwork archive brings together a selection of past works by Cerisia Ta’Torin, spanning multiple collections, materials, and moments in her practice. These pieces reflect an evolving relationship with colour, texture, storytelling, and place. Some works now live in private collections, others marked turning points in technique or theme, and a few continue to echo into current series.
The archive is not chronological or complete, but acts as a visual map of experimentation, play, and return.
